A blinding snowstorm--and a homicidal maniac--traps a small party of friends in an isolated estate. The plot later takes on a claustrophobic feeling that leads into an unexpected end. Out of this deceptively simple set-up, Agatha Christie fashioned one of her most ingenious puzzlers that later became a successful play. "This classic title novella showcases the inimitable Christie at her inventive best, proving her reputation as "the champion deceiver of our time." (The New York Times)
